Creamy Alfredo, Cheesy Mac, and Fresh Broccoli (Comforting and Family-Friendly)

Why You’ll Love This Recipe

Creamy Alfredo, Cheesy Mac, and Fresh Broccoli is the ultimate comfort-food combination that brings richness, familiarity, and freshness together in one satisfying dish. The silky Alfredo sauce coats tender pasta, the melted cheese adds indulgent depth, and the broccoli provides a fresh, slightly crisp contrast that keeps the dish balanced rather than heavy. I have made this recipe many times when I wanted something cozy yet dependable, and it always delivers. It is perfect for family dinners, potlucks, or busy evenings when you want a meal that feels hearty without being complicated. This dish is also incredibly versatile, working well as a main course or as a substantial side. If you enjoy creamy pasta dishes but appreciate a touch of freshness, this recipe is an excellent choice.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Creamy Alfredo, Cheesy Mac, and Fresh Broccoli (Comforting and Family-Friendly)


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Emma
  • Total Time: 30 minutes
  • Yield: 4 servings
  • Diet: Vegetarian

Description

Creamy Alfredo, Cheesy Mac, and Fresh Broccoli is a comforting pasta dish that combines rich Alfredo sauce, classic cheesy macaroni, and tender broccoli for a creamy, satisfying meal.


Ingredients

  • 8 oz elbow macaroni
  • 2 cups fresh broccoli florets
  • 2 tablespoons butter
  • 2 cloves garlic, minced
  • 1 cup heavy cream
  • 1/2 cup whole milk
  • 1 cup grated Parmesan cheese
  • 1 cup shredded cheddar cheese
  • Salt and black pepper, to taste
  • 1/4 teaspoon nutmeg (optional)


Instructions

  1. Bring a large pot of salted water to a boil and cook macaroni according to package instructions.
  2. Add broccoli florets during the last 2 minutes of cooking, then drain and set aside.
  3. In a saucepan over medium heat, melt butter and sauté garlic for 30 seconds until fragrant.
  4. Stir in heavy cream and milk and bring to a gentle simmer.
  5. Add Parmesan cheese, stirring until melted and smooth.
  6. Season with salt, black pepper, and nutmeg if using.
  7. Stir in cooked macaroni, broccoli, and cheddar cheese until well combined and creamy.
  8. Cook for 2–3 minutes until cheese is fully melted and everything is heated through.
  9. Serve hot.

Notes

  • For extra creaminess, add an extra splash of milk.
  • Grilled chicken or shrimp can be added for protein.
  • Best served immediately.
  • Prep Time: 10 minutes
  • Cook Time: 20 minutes
  • Category: Main Course
  • Method: Boiling & Simmering
  • Cuisine: American-Italian

Ingredients

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

Elbow Macaroni
Elbow macaroni is ideal for holding creamy sauces and melted cheese, creating the classic mac-and-cheese texture.

Broccoli Florets
Fresh broccoli adds color, texture, and balance. Lightly cooking it keeps it vibrant and slightly crisp.

Butter
Butter forms the base of the Alfredo sauce and adds richness.

Garlic
Garlic provides savory depth and enhances the creamy sauce.

Heavy Cream
Heavy cream creates the smooth, velvety Alfredo base.

Milk
Milk lightens the sauce slightly while maintaining creaminess.

Parmesan Cheese
Parmesan adds sharp, savory flavor and thickens the Alfredo sauce naturally.

Cheddar Cheese
Cheddar cheese brings classic mac-and-cheese flavor and a rich, melty texture.

Salt
Salt enhances the flavors of the pasta, cheese, and sauce.

Black Pepper
Black pepper adds gentle warmth and balance.

Nutmeg
A small amount of nutmeg adds subtle warmth and depth to the creamy sauce.

Directions

Bring a large pot of salted water to a boil. Cook the macaroni according to package instructions until al dente. During the last 2 minutes of cooking, add the broccoli florets to the pot. Drain and set aside.

In a large saucepan over medium heat, melt the butter. Add the minced garlic and cook for about 30 seconds until fragrant.

Pour in the heavy cream and milk, stirring gently. Allow the mixture to warm without boiling. Stir in the Parmesan cheese and whisk until smooth and slightly thickened.

Reduce the heat to low and add the cheddar cheese, stirring until fully melted. Season with salt, black pepper, and nutmeg.

Add the cooked macaroni and broccoli to the sauce. Stir gently until everything is evenly coated and heated through.

Serve immediately while hot and creamy.

Equipment needed :

Must-Have Tools to Get Rolling
Here’s what you’ll want to have on hand:

Silicone Spatula â€“ Durable, heat-resistant silicone spatula perfect for mixing, scraping, and spreading. Gentle on non-stick cookware and easy to clean.

Large pot â€“ You’ll need this to boil the whole cabbage head and soften the leaves.

large bowl â€“Spacious, durable large bowl ideal for mixing, serving, or food preparation. Made from sturdy material and easy to clean.

Sharp knife â€“ For coring the cabbage and slicing out the thick stem in each leaf. A paring knife works best.

Mixing bowl â€“ A big bowl makes it easier to combine your meat and rice filling evenly.

Cutting board â€“ For prepping cabbage leaves and rolling them like a pro.

Full-Size Blender â€“ is a powerful kitchen appliance for making smoothies, soups, and sauces in large batches.

 3-in-1 Air Fryer â€“ This versatile 3-in-1 air fryer offers Air Fry for healthier meals with less oil, Bake for bakery-quality desserts and treats, and Reheat to bring leftovers back to life with crispy, flavorful results.

Servings and timing

This recipe serves 4 to 6 people.
Preparation time: 10 minutes
Cooking time: 25 minutes
Total time: approximately 35 minutes

Storage/reheating

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stovetop or in the microwave with a splash of milk to restore creaminess.

Variations and Customizations

This dish is easy to adapt. You can add grilled chicken, shrimp, or crispy bacon for extra protein. I tested it with grilled chicken, and it turned the dish into a filling main course.

For a sharper cheese flavor, substitute part of the cheddar with sharp white cheddar or Gruyère.

If you prefer extra vegetables, add sautéed mushrooms or peas along with the broccoli.

For a lighter version, use half-and-half instead of heavy cream and reduce the cheese slightly. The dish remains creamy while being less rich.

Nutrition and Dietary Info

Approximate nutrition per serving:

NutrientAmount
Calories540 kcal
Protein20 g
Carbs46 g
Fat32 g
Saturated Fat18 g
Fiber4 g
Sugar6 g
Sodium620 mg

Expert Tips & Customizations

Cook Pasta Al Dente
This prevents the pasta from becoming too soft.

Do Not Boil the Cream
Gentle heat keeps the sauce smooth.

Use Freshly Grated Cheese
It melts better and improves texture.

Season Gradually
Cheese adds salt, so taste as you go.

Serve Immediately
Creamy sauces are best fresh.

FAQs

Can I use frozen broccoli?

Yes, thaw and drain it well before adding.

Can I make this ahead of time?

It is best served fresh, but reheats well with added milk.

What pasta shapes work besides macaroni?

Shells, penne, or cavatappi work well.

Can I bake this dish?

Yes, transfer to a baking dish, top with cheese, and bake until bubbly.

Is this recipe kid-friendly?

Yes, the mild, creamy flavors are popular with children.

Can I make it gluten-free?

Use gluten-free pasta and ensure cheeses are gluten-free.

Conclusion

Creamy Alfredo, Cheesy Mac, and Fresh Broccoli is a comforting, well-balanced dish that combines indulgent creaminess with fresh texture. Easy to prepare and endlessly adaptable, it is perfect for weeknight dinners, family gatherings, or anytime you want a reliable, satisfying meal. This recipe proves that classic comfort food can still feel fresh and complete.

Hungry for more?  Visit our website for full recipes and follow us on Pinterest for daily foodie inspo you’ll love to pin!

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star